Transaction df7852859668fd21e25c5497c6f80f5e549af5395f49a97b937378617a106a87

1 Input
2 Outputs
  • df7852859668fd21e25c5497c6f80f5e549af5395f49a97b937378617a106a87:0
  • value  42772
    address  12GYKYNztBXmfHgCk6pxfJRQtLqxQrhtmp
  • df7852859668fd21e25c5497c6f80f5e549af5395f49a97b937378617a106a87:1
  • value  52224
    address  34dqDnCEpkaPYoUVfk3xUzp3PNsC29eHDh